DFG Funds Second Phase of TRR 339 “Digital Twin Road”

18 May 2026

We are excited that the German Research Foundation (DFG) has awarded funding for the second funding period of TRR 339 “Digital Twin Road – Physical Informational Representation of the Future Road System.”

 

At Bundeswehr University Munich, we are very happy to continue contributing to this collaborative research initiative together with colleagues from RWTH Aachen University, Technische Universität Dresden, and the Federal Highway and Transport Research Institute (BASt).

We are especially pleased to continue the collaboration with Simon Schäfer as a postdoctoral researcher in our group and with Ehsan Hashemi from the University of Alberta, with whom we already collaborated during the first project phase.

Collaborative Research Centers provide a unique framework for the long-term and collaborative pursuit of innovative and challenging research questions. We are grateful to continue being part of this interdisciplinary effort and look forward to the next phase of TRR 339.
